Langages de programmation Web - Vos options
Publié le: 3 juillet 2010Tags: ASP , C + + , COBOL , Cold Fusion , Java , . Net de Microsoft , Perl , PHP , Ruby , VB , VB.net , VC + +
Au fil des ans plusieurs langages de programmation ont fait leur apparition sur la scène et certains ont gardé le cap. Le premier langage de programmation pour la frapper grande dans le commerce avec les applications métiers était COBOL dans les jours Mainframe. Ceci a été suivi par C et C + +, quand l'ère client-serveur est venu brièvement, Microsoft a lancé VB, VC + +. L'arrivée de l'Internet a engendré plusieurs nouvelles langues telles que ASP, Perl, Java, Cold Fusio n, Ruby, C #.
COBOL a encore ses remerciements Forte aux applications héritées et IBM C / C + + a toujours conservé son fief -. Ingénierie et les systèmes embarqués.
Sur le front web, qui a vu des applications énormes et l'innovation, quelques langues se distinguent en termes de popularité - Java, Microsoft Net (C # / VB.net), PHP, Ruby (on Rails)..
Comment peut-on décider quelle langue utiliser? Un grand nombre de facteurs entrent en jeu, quelques-uns des principaux étant:
- Héritage
- Coût - développement, les outils, les produits
- Communauté - la popularité, la taille de la base d'utilisateurs, de développeurs
- Support - fournisseurs de produits, des groupes d'utilisateurs, propriétaires / Open Source
- Développement - rapidité, la simplicité, la facilité
- Performance
- Plate-forme - Enterprise, Internet, Mobile, etc périphériques.
- Type d'application - Contenu, transactionnel, la collaboration ....
Si vous êtes une entreprise établie, un grand nombre de fois cela est dicté par l'environnement actuel, si vous êtes une boutique IBM / Sun / Oracle vous allez probablement la façon dont Java/J2EE. Plupart des grandes entreprises ont choisi d'emprunter la voie J2EE principalement en raison de sa non-exclusive la nature, le soutien de plusieurs fournisseurs et de son avantage du premier entrant comme une plate-forme d'entreprise robuste pour le web. Si vous avez été une usine de Microsoft, le choix est évident. Microsoft ne particulièrement bien avec les entreprises de taille moyenne et dans plusieurs marchés non américains. PHP et Ruby semblent aller de front et la concurrence dans les segments similaires. Les startups et les nouvelles entreprises n'ont pas les frais généraux hérités et sont donc libres de choisir n'importe quelle plateforme. Aussi, quand la chasse est pour le meilleur produit COTS ajustement ou de la solution plutôt que d'une application sur mesure, langage de programmation devient secondaire et plus une conséquence que le choix.
En résumé, le champ s'est rétréci vers le bas pour quelques langues, dont chacune a sa niche et domaines d'application. Le consommateur a maintenant des choix stables à choisir de, il est un bon moment et le réglage à être dedans!






















































